Gnr*_*zik 5 apache mod-rewrite cakephp wamp
所以,我想知道是否有人可以澄清以下事件,并可能建议我如何解决这个问题.
对不起代码的奇怪着色
让我先解释一下这个设置.我安装了wamp服务器,它实际上位于一个高清,然后我的开发文件位于单独的高清.所以我添加了别名来访问特定的dev文件夹
在httpd.conf我有以下
ServerRoot D:/Program Files/wamp/bin/apache/apache2.2.11
Listen 80
ServerName localhost:80
DocumentRoot D:/Program Files/wamp/www
<Directory />
Options FollowSymLinks
AllowOverride None
Order deny,allow
Deny from all
</Directory>
<Directory D:/Program Files/wamp/www/>
Options Indexes FollowSymLinks
AllowOverride all
Order Allow,Deny
Allow from all
</Directory>
Run Code Online (Sandbox Code Playgroud)
以下是单独的conf文件并包含在httpd.conf中
Alias /project_birthday_planner "E:/Development/--- Projects-Full/PROJECT - BirthdayPlanner/trunk/"
<Directory E:/Development/--- Projects-Full/PROJECT - BirthdayPlanner/trunk/>
Options Indexes FollowSymlinks MultiViews
AllowOverride All
Order allow,deny
Allow from all
</Directory>
Run Code Online (Sandbox Code Playgroud)
在我的E:/ Development/--- Projects-Full/PROJECT - BirthdayPlanner/trunk /我有我的cakephp目录和文件
这是问题所在
我的模式重写已打开,我的后续cakephp文件夹的htaccess文件如下,
cakephp的根
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teBase /
RewriteRule ^$ /app/webroot/ [L]
RewriteRule (.*) /app/webroot/$1 [L]
</IfModule>
Run Code Online (Sandbox Code Playgroud)
*\*应用程序
<IfModule mod_rewrite.c>
RewriteEngine on
RewriteBase /
RewriteRule ^$ /webroot/ [L]
RewriteRule (.*) /webroot/$1 [L]
</IfModule>
Run Code Online (Sandbox Code Playgroud)
*\程序\ webroot的*
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-d
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 index.php?url=$1 [QSA,L]
</IfModule>
Run Code Online (Sandbox Code Playgroud)
当我访问/ project_birthday_planner时,我得到以下错误404 Not Found
**Not Found**
The requested URL /app/webroot/ was not found on this server.
Run Code Online (Sandbox Code Playgroud)
如果我将DocumentRoot设置为我的cakephp文件夹或将cakephp文件夹和文件移动到初始DocucumentRoot文件夹,则所有文件都会启动并运行.
问题是 我如何解决这个问题,这是一个本质上是使用apache别名的东西或我错过了一些
这个设置应该通过VirtualHost解决吗?
非常感谢你
| 归档时间: |
|
| 查看次数: |
7778 次 |
| 最近记录: |